Vulliafans with around 700 inhabitants in the Doubs department in the Bourgogne-Franche-Comté region - a magical place with the Pont Vieux - this bridge with its 3 arches was built in the 17th century. Further into the town center there are numerous town and farm houses that were built in the characteristic style of Franche-Comté in the 16th to 18th centuries. One of the oldest houses is the former manor house La Forteresse from the 14th/15th century. The really beautiful thing is the authentic flair.

The Église de l’Assomption de Vuillafans is a historic church building in Vuillafans, located in the Doubs department, France. Construction of the church began in 1429 and lasted until its consecration in 1522. It has a striking architecture with a clocher-porche and ogival vaults. The furnishings include a beautiful retable from 1702, a pulpit from 1704 and paintings from around 1515. The church has been registered as a historical monument since 1939.

The Maison de Balthazar Gérard is a 15th century house located in Vuillafans. The house is associated with Balthazar Gérard, the assassin of William of Orange in 1584. The Maison de Balthazar Gérard has a striking Gothic portal and is decorated with various sculptures, including an image of Saint Lazare and a human head with large ears and bunches of grapes.

There are over 140 touring cycling routes around Saules, offering a wide variety of experiences. This includes 12 easy routes, 58 moderate routes, and 74 difficult routes, catering to different skill levels and preferences.
The terrain around Saules is characterized by rolling hills, dense forests, and picturesque river valleys. You'll find a mix of easy cycle paths, such as the Vuillafans – Val d'Ornans cycle path loop from Ornans, and more challenging routes with significant elevation gain, like the View of Roche Bottine – Val d'Ornans cycle path loop from Ornans, which features over 500 meters of ascent.
Yes, there are 12 easy touring cycling routes suitable for families. The Vuillafans – Val d'Ornans cycle path loop from Ornans is an excellent option, being an easy 15.1 km path that follows a dedicated cycle path through the scenic Val d'Ornans, making it ideal for a relaxed family outing.
The region offers stunning natural scenery. You can cycle past the impressive View of Roche Bottine, explore areas with natural monuments like Column Rock and Rocher du Tourbillon, or even encounter the beautiful Vau Waterfall. Many routes, such as Cycling through a green gorge – Ancien pont ferroviaire loop from Ornans, offer views of picturesque gorges and river valleys.
Absolutely. The area is rich in history. You can cycle past the historic Cléron Castle, as seen on the Cléron Castle – Old railway bridge loop from Ornans route. Other points of interest include the Old railway bridge and the Former tile factory of Combes Punay. Nearby medieval villages like Saint-Gengoux-le-National also offer charming historical streets and architecture.

While specific seasonal data isn't provided, the Bourgogne-Franche-Comté region generally offers pleasant cycling conditions from spring through early autumn (April to October). During these months, the weather is typically mild, and the natural scenery is at its most vibrant, making it ideal for exploring the rolling hills and river valleys.
Yes, the area is becoming more cyclist-friendly. In nearby Saint-Gengoux-le-National, you can find an 'Aire de loisir de la gare' (leisure area at the station) which is equipped with a bicycle repair station and offers muscle or electric bike rental services, along with picnic tables and toilets.
